Getting There

  • Walking

    From the Inner Harbor area, head towards the water and look for the harbor promenade. Walk along the promenade towards the south. Continue walking until you reach the intersection of Light Street and Key Highway. The Maryland Science Center will be on your left at 601 Light St. This should take about 10-15 minutes depending on your pace.

  • Water Taxi

    If you prefer a scenic route, consider taking a water taxi from one of the nearby docks in Inner Harbor. Look for the water taxi sign, and purchase a ticket (usually around $10 for a single ride). Board the water taxi and inform the captain you want to go to the Maryland Science Center stop. The ride will give you a unique view of the harbor and will take about 5 minutes. Once you disembark, the Science Center will be just a short walk away.

Discover more about Maryland Science Center

Nestled in the heart of Baltimore's Inner Harbor, the Maryland Science Center stands as a premier destination for science enthusiasts and families alike. This dynamic science museum offers an array of interactive exhibits that engage visitors in the wonders of the natural world and the marvels of technology. With its focus on hands-on learning, the Maryland Science Center invites guests to explore everything from the intricacies of the human body to the vastness of space. A highlight of the center is its state-of-the-art planetarium, where visitors can embark on a celestial journey, marveling at the stars and planets while learning about the universe. Beyond the planetarium, the center features a variety of educational programs and workshops tailored for all ages, making it an ideal stop for families looking to inspire a love of learning in children. The exhibits change regularly, ensuring that both first-time visitors and returning guests always find something new to discover. Additionally, the center’s location on the waterfront allows visitors to enjoy picturesque views and take advantage of the many dining and shopping options nearby.
